📊 ENDURANCE shows solid fundamentals with strong ROCE (21.5%) and ROE (16.1%), supported by very low debt-to-equity (0.02). EPS of 49.6 ₹ reflects earnings strength, but the stock trades at a premium P/E of 44.1 compared to industry average (23.7). Technical indicators are weak (RSI 33.5, MACD -49.3), and the price is below both DMA 50 (2,503 ₹) and DMA 200 (2,546 ₹), indicating bearish momentum. This makes it a cautious swing trade candidate, with potential rebound if entered near support.
